Trahald
26th February 2006, 18:04
there cannot be any gaps in audio for seamless connections. seems the audio is a tad short. a way to get around this is to add blank audio to the end of the audio file(s). use delay cut by jsoto (found on this forum) and uncheck 'cut file' and 'original length' and set all values to 0 except the Delay 'End' to a -1000 which will add 1 second of silence to the file. use the new audio in the project. scenarist will only mux what it needs and truncate the rest of the audio. with seemless connections you are better off with too much audio than too little
